How they compare

Kyrgyzstan currently reports 0.0212 1000 No per square kilometre against 0.021 1000 No per square kilometre in Faroe Islands, a difference of 0.0002 1000 No per square kilometre.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 32 shared years of data; in 1992 it was Faroe Islands ahead.

Faroe Islands ranks 110th and Kyrgyzstan ranks 109th of 190 countries.

Faroe Islands has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
